John of Damascus — on Isa 1:18 (BARLAAM AND JOSEPH 32)

Patristic A.D. 749
John of Damascus · A.D. 676–749
“Such therefore being the promises made by God to them that turn to him, don't delay … but draw near to Christ, our loving God, and be enlightened, and your face shall not be ashamed. For as soon as you go down into the bath of holy baptism, all the defilement of the old nature and all the burden of your many sins are buried in the water and pass into nothingness. And you come up from there a new person, pure from all pollution, with no spot or wrinkle of sin upon you.”
